Retail ERP Licensing Decision: Unlimited Users Odoo vs Per-User SAP, Oracle, NetSuite, and Dynamics
Retail ERP selection is often framed around features, industry fit, and implementation risk. In practice, licensing structure can materially change total cost of ownership, user adoption, rollout strategy, and long-term operating flexibility. For retail organizations with large store networks, seasonal staffing, distributed warehouse teams, franchise operations, and broad back-office participation, the difference between unlimited-user licensing and per-user licensing is not a minor commercial detail. It can shape the entire ERP business case.
This comparison examines Odoo's unlimited-user model against the more common per-user approaches associated with SAP, Oracle, NetSuite, and Microsoft Dynamics 365. The goal is not to declare a universal winner. The right decision depends on retail operating model, process complexity, compliance requirements, geographic footprint, internal IT maturity, and how broadly the business intends to extend ERP access across stores, finance, supply chain, eCommerce, customer service, and partner ecosystems.
Why licensing structure matters in retail ERP
Retail is unusually sensitive to ERP licensing design because user populations are large, fluid, and operationally diverse. A retailer may need access for store managers, assistant managers, buyers, planners, warehouse staff, finance users, HR teams, customer service agents, eCommerce operators, regional leaders, franchise users, and temporary seasonal workers. In a per-user model, each expansion of process participation can increase recurring software cost. In an unlimited-user model, the marginal cost of adding users is lower, but other cost drivers such as implementation scope, hosting, support, and customization may become more significant.
- Per-user licensing can create cost discipline but may discourage broad operational adoption.
- Unlimited-user licensing can support wider process participation but does not eliminate implementation complexity.
- Retailers with high employee turnover or seasonal staffing often feel per-user pricing pressure more acutely.
- The more workflows that require occasional access, approvals, or data entry, the more licensing structure affects ROI.

Pricing comparison: unlimited users versus per-user economics
The most important pricing distinction is not simply subscription amount. It is how cost behaves as the organization grows. Odoo's unlimited-user positioning is attractive for retailers that want to extend ERP access broadly without negotiating every additional user. That can be especially relevant for multi-store operations, warehouse-heavy businesses, and organizations with many occasional users. However, buyers should not assume unlimited users means low total cost in every scenario. Costs can still increase through app selection, implementation services, custom development, infrastructure, support, and future rework if the initial design is weak.
By contrast, SAP, Oracle, NetSuite, and Dynamics often provide more structured commercial models tied to user roles, modules, entities, or transaction volumes. These models can be appropriate when access is tightly controlled and process ownership is concentrated among a smaller set of power users. But in retail, where many users need at least some level of participation, per-user pricing can create friction. Organizations may delay rollout to stores, limit approvals to a few managers, or keep staff on spreadsheets to avoid licensing expansion.

Implementation complexity and operational fit
Licensing should not be evaluated in isolation from implementation complexity. Odoo can be appealing because broad user access supports operational adoption, but implementation outcomes vary significantly based on partner capability, process design, and governance. For retailers with relatively straightforward merchandising, inventory, purchasing, finance, and eCommerce requirements, Odoo can provide a flexible platform with lower user-cost friction. For retailers with highly complex pricing engines, advanced replenishment logic, deep omnichannel orchestration, strict segregation-of-duties requirements, or extensive country-specific compliance needs, the implementation burden may rise quickly.
SAP and Oracle are often selected where process rigor, enterprise controls, and large-scale complexity are central decision criteria. Their implementations are usually more structured and more resource-intensive. NetSuite often sits in a middle position, offering cloud standardization with less infrastructure burden than traditional enterprise suites, though retail-specific depth may still require extensions. Dynamics 365 can be attractive for retailers that want modular adoption and strong Microsoft ecosystem alignment, but implementation complexity can increase when multiple apps, ISV solutions, and custom integrations are combined.
- Odoo: lower user-cost friction, but implementation quality is highly partner-dependent.
- SAP: strong enterprise process depth, but longer timelines and heavier change management are common.
- Oracle: suitable for complex enterprise environments, though commercial and implementation planning can be demanding.
- NetSuite: often faster to cloud standardization, but retail-specific gaps may require add-ons.
- Dynamics 365: flexible and ecosystem-friendly, but architecture decisions strongly affect complexity.
Scalability analysis for growing retail organizations
Scalability has two dimensions: technical scale and organizational scale. Technical scale concerns transaction volumes, entities, geographies, and performance. Organizational scale concerns how many people, teams, stores, and partners can realistically participate in the system without cost or process bottlenecks. Odoo's unlimited-user model is particularly relevant to organizational scale. It allows retailers to include more users in workflows such as inventory counts, approvals, purchasing requests, store transfers, and reporting access without the same recurring license pressure.
However, technical and governance scalability may favor SAP, Oracle, or in some cases Dynamics and NetSuite for larger or more regulated retail enterprises. If the business expects complex multi-country operations, sophisticated financial controls, advanced supply chain planning, or extensive audit requirements, the broader enterprise platforms may provide more mature structures. The tradeoff is that scaling users and capabilities often scales cost and implementation effort as well.

Integration comparison
Retail ERP rarely operates alone. It must connect with POS, eCommerce platforms, marketplaces, payment systems, tax engines, warehouse systems, EDI providers, BI tools, HR systems, and customer platforms. Odoo offers broad functional coverage and API-based integration options, which can reduce the number of separate systems in some environments. That can simplify architecture for mid-market retailers. But integration quality depends heavily on implementation design and connector maturity.
SAP, Oracle, NetSuite, and Dynamics generally benefit from larger enterprise integration ecosystems, established middleware patterns, and broader third-party support. For retailers with many legacy systems or complex omnichannel landscapes, that ecosystem maturity can reduce risk. The downside is that integration architecture may become more layered and expensive.

Customization analysis
Customization is where licensing savings can be lost if governance is weak. Odoo is often chosen because it is flexible and can be adapted to retail workflows. That flexibility is useful, but it can also encourage over-customization. Retailers should distinguish between configuration, extension, and core-code modification. The more the solution diverges from standard patterns, the more upgrade risk and support dependency increase.
SAP and Oracle usually impose more formal design discipline, which can slow change but also reduce uncontrolled customization. NetSuite and Dynamics offer extensibility models that can be effective when used carefully, though buyers should still assess long-term maintainability, release compatibility, and partner dependency. The key question is not which platform can be customized most. It is which platform can support necessary differentiation without creating an expensive support burden.
- Odoo favors flexibility and speed, but requires strong solution governance.
- SAP and Oracle often support more formal enterprise design controls.
- NetSuite and Dynamics can balance extensibility with cloud governance if architecture is disciplined.
- Retailers should quantify the cost of every customization against process value and upgrade impact.

Migration considerations
Migration into a new retail ERP is rarely limited to data conversion. It usually includes process redesign, chart of accounts alignment, item master cleanup, supplier normalization, store hierarchy rationalization, and integration replacement. Odoo migrations can be attractive for retailers moving off spreadsheets, disconnected point solutions, or aging mid-market systems because the licensing model supports broad rollout. But migration success depends on data quality and process simplification.
Migrating to SAP, Oracle, NetSuite, or Dynamics may involve more formal transformation programs, especially if the target state includes stronger controls, multi-entity standardization, or enterprise reporting redesign. These programs can deliver long-term benefits, but they require more executive sponsorship, stronger PMO discipline, and larger change budgets.
- Assess whether current user counts are suppressed by legacy licensing constraints.
- Model future-state access needs for stores, warehouses, and temporary staff.
- Clean product, vendor, customer, and inventory data before platform selection assumptions are finalized.
- Evaluate whether migration scope includes process harmonization across banners, brands, or regions.
- Do not treat unlimited users as a substitute for role design, security, and training.

Executive decision guidance
For retail executives, the core question is not whether unlimited users are inherently better than per-user licensing. The question is whether your operating model benefits more from broad participation or from tightly controlled enterprise structure. If store-level adoption, warehouse participation, seasonal workforce access, and cross-functional workflow coverage are central to value realization, Odoo's licensing model deserves serious consideration. If the organization's priority is enterprise-grade governance, global complexity management, and formal process control, SAP, Oracle, NetSuite, or Dynamics may justify their licensing structure despite higher user-cost sensitivity.
A practical evaluation framework is to model three scenarios: current-state user counts, realistic two-year adoption counts, and full target-state participation. Then compare not only subscription cost, but also implementation effort, integration architecture, customization burden, support model, and upgrade risk. In many retail cases, the cheapest-looking license model is not the lowest TCO, and the most expensive-looking user model is not always the wrong strategic fit. The best decision is the one that aligns licensing economics with operating design, governance maturity, and transformation ambition.
